Ingredients:

1 1/2 sticks of butter or margarine 'softened'

2/3 cup firmly packed light brown sugar

1 large egg

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

1 3/4 cup of all-purpose flour

3/4 teaspoon baking soda

1/4 teaspoon salt

3/4 cup coarsely chopped macadamia nuts ( I prefer chopped pecans)

1/2 cup shredded coconut

1 3/4 cups of M&Ms color of your choice

Directions:

Preheat oven to 350F. In large bowl c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y; slowly beat in egg and vanilla. In a seperate medium bowl combine flour, baking soda, and salt; blend into creamed mixture.Blend in nuts and coconut. Stir in M&Ms. Drop by teaspoon full about 2 inches apart on and UNgreased baking sheet. You can flatten out by pushing down with a spoon if you want a more perfectionate look. Bake 8 to 10 minute or until set. Do NOT overbake these burn easy so keep a good look at them. Cool 1 minute on cookie cookie sheets.
